怎么实现数据仓库

回复

共3条回复 我来回复
  • Rayna
    这个人很懒,什么都没有留下~
    评论

    实现数据仓库的过程涉及多个关键步骤,首先需要确定数据仓库的需求、选择合适的技术架构、设计数据模型、实施数据集成和加载、并建立有效的数据访问机制。其中,设计数据模型是实现数据仓库的核心环节。数据模型的设计不仅要考虑数据的存储结构,还要确保可以支持高效的数据查询和分析。合理的数据模型能够显著提高数据仓库的性能和可扩展性,为企业决策提供准确的支持。

    一、确定数据仓库需求

    明确数据仓库的需求是实施数据仓库的第一步。企业需要与相关利益相关者进行深入的沟通,了解他们的数据需求和业务目标。这一阶段包括对现有数据源的评估,明确所需的数据类型、数据量、数据更新频率等信息。通过需求分析,企业可以制定出清晰的数据仓库建设目标,确保后续工作的方向性和有效性。

    在需求分析过程中,企业还需要考虑业务用户的使用习惯和分析需求。这包括对报表、分析工具和数据可视化工具的需求,确保数据仓库能够支持不同层次的用户需求。同时,需求分析还应关注数据的质量要求,确保所构建的数据仓库能够提供可靠的数据支持。

    二、选择合适的技术架构

    在明确需求之后,选择合适的技术架构是实施数据仓库的关键环节。数据仓库的架构通常分为三种类型:单层架构、双层架构和三层架构。三层架构是目前最为常用的架构,它分别包括数据源层、数据仓库层和数据访问层。在三层架构中,数据源层负责数据的采集,数据仓库层负责数据的存储与管理,而数据访问层则提供用户与数据交互的接口。

    选择技术架构时,企业需要考虑数据量、并发用户数、系统可扩展性等因素。此外,企业还应评估现有的IT基础设施,以确保选定的架构能够与现有系统进行有效集成。适合的技术架构不仅能够支持当前的业务需求,还能适应未来的业务发展,提供长久的技术保障。

    三、设计数据模型

    数据模型的设计是数据仓库实施中至关重要的环节。合理的数据模型能够提高数据的查询效率和存储效率。在数据模型设计中,常用的建模方法包括星型模型和雪花模型。星型模型通过将事实表与维度表相连,形成一个简单而高效的数据查询结构;而雪花模型则在维度表上进行进一步的规范化,适用于更复杂的数据关系。

    设计数据模型时,必须清晰定义每个维度和事实的属性,确保数据的一致性和完整性。同时,要考虑数据的可扩展性,以便在未来增加新的数据源或业务需求时,能够轻松进行调整和扩展。数据模型的设计不仅影响数据的存储方式,也直接关系到后续的数据分析和报告的效率。

    四、实施数据集成和加载

    数据集成和加载是实现数据仓库的重要步骤。在这个阶段,企业需要从多个数据源中提取数据,并将其转换成数据仓库所需的格式。ETL(提取、转换、加载)过程是实现数据集成的核心。通过ETL工具,企业可以自动化数据的提取和转换,提高数据加载的效率。

    在实施数据加载时,要充分考虑数据的质量和完整性。数据清洗和数据验证是ETL过程中的重要环节,通过这些步骤可以确保数据在加载到数据仓库之前是准确和一致的。此外,企业还需要定期进行数据加载任务的监控和维护,以确保数据仓库中的数据始终保持最新状态,满足业务用户的需求。

    五、建立有效的数据访问机制

    数据访问机制的建立是数据仓库实施的最后一步。企业需要提供便捷的数据访问方式,以支持不同层次的用户进行数据查询和分析。数据访问层的设计应考虑用户的使用习惯和访问权限,确保用户能够轻松获取所需的数据,同时保护敏感信息的安全性。

    在数据访问机制中,企业可以使用多种工具和技术,如OLAP(在线分析处理)、数据可视化工具和自助分析工具等。这些工具能够帮助用户更直观地理解数据,从而提高数据分析的效率。同时,企业还应提供相应的培训和支持,帮助用户熟悉数据仓库的使用,最大化地发挥数据仓库的价值。

    1年前 0条评论
  • Marjorie
    这个人很懒,什么都没有留下~
    评论

    要实现数据仓库,需要明确业务需求、设计数据模型、选择合适的ETL工具、建立数据集市、实施数据质量管理。在明确业务需求时,企业需要与各个部门进行深入沟通,了解他们的数据分析需求,以便为数据仓库的设计提供指导。明确需求的过程不仅要关注当前的数据使用情况,还要考虑未来可能的扩展需求。例如,企业可能需要分析客户行为、销售趋势或财务报表,了解这些需求后,可以更好地定义数据模型和数据结构,从而确保数据仓库能够满足多样化的分析要求。

    一、明确业务需求

    明确业务需求是构建数据仓库的第一步。企业需要与各业务部门进行详细的访谈和需求收集,以便理解他们在数据分析方面的痛点和需求。这包括了解哪些数据对决策至关重要、分析的频率、所需的报告类型等。通过这些信息,企业能够识别出关键信息领域,并为后续的数据模型设计提供指导。需求收集的过程可以采用问卷调查、访谈、研讨会等多种形式,确保覆盖所有相关利益相关者。同时,应考虑未来的业务变化,确保数据仓库具备一定的灵活性,以适应新的业务需求。

    二、设计数据模型

    数据模型设计是数据仓库建设的重要环节。数据模型主要分为概念模型、逻辑模型和物理模型。概念模型主要定义数据的基本结构和关系,逻辑模型则进一步细化,考虑如何在数据库中实现这些结构,而物理模型则关注存储和性能优化。对于数据仓库而言,星型和雪花型模型是常见的数据组织方式。星型模型通过将事实表与维度表直接连接,便于查询和分析;而雪花型模型则对维度表进行进一步的规范化,减少冗余。设计时需要考虑数据的可扩展性、查询性能以及数据一致性等因素,确保数据模型能够支持复杂的分析需求。

    三、选择合适的ETL工具

    ETL(提取、转换、加载)是将数据从源系统导入数据仓库的关键过程。选择合适的ETL工具对于数据仓库的构建至关重要。市场上有多种ETL工具可供选择,如Apache Nifi、Talend、Informatica等。这些工具各有优缺点,企业需根据自身需求进行选择。例如,如果企业需要处理大量的实时数据流,可能更倾向于选择支持实时数据处理的工具。ETL过程包括数据提取、数据清洗、数据转换和数据加载。数据提取阶段需要从各种源系统中获取数据,数据清洗则是消除重复、修复错误等,数据转换则是将数据转化为适合分析的格式,最后将数据加载到数据仓库中。

    四、建立数据集市

    数据集市是数据仓库的一个子集,专注于特定业务领域或团队。建立数据集市可以提高数据访问的灵活性和效率,使不同部门能够快速获取所需的数据。数据集市的设计应基于实际的业务需求,并与整体数据仓库的架构相协调。通过建立数据集市,企业能够将数据仓库中的数据进行分类和整理,便于特定用户群体进行分析。数据集市可以采用独立的存储方案,也可以与数据仓库共享同一基础设施。重点在于确保数据的一致性和实时性,以支持快速的业务决策。

    五、实施数据质量管理

    数据质量管理是数据仓库建设过程中不可忽视的一环。高质量的数据是数据分析和决策的基础,企业需要建立一套完善的数据质量管理机制。这包括数据验证、数据清洗、数据监控等多个方面。首先,企业需要在ETL过程中设置数据验证规则,确保数据在进入数据仓库前是准确和完整的。其次,定期进行数据清洗,消除冗余、纠正错误,以保持数据的高质量。此外,还应建立数据监控机制,实时监测数据的质量,并及时处理问题。通过有效的数据质量管理,企业能够确保数据仓库中的数据是可靠的,从而为决策提供有力支持。

    六、选择合适的存储方案

    选择合适的存储方案是数据仓库建设中的关键决策之一。存储方案的选择直接影响到数据的访问速度、存储成本和扩展能力。企业可以选择传统的关系型数据库,或是现代的云存储解决方案。关系型数据库适合结构化数据的存储和管理,能够提供强大的查询功能;而云存储方案则可以提供更高的灵活性和可扩展性,适合大规模数据的存储和分析。对于需要实时分析的场景,企业可以考虑使用数据湖等新型存储方案,将结构化和非结构化数据进行统一管理。选择存储方案时需综合考虑数据量、访问频率、预算等因素,确保能够满足企业的长期需求。

    七、确保数据安全和合规

    在构建数据仓库时,数据安全和合规性是必须优先考虑的问题。企业需遵循相关法律法规,如GDPR、CCPA等,确保用户数据的隐私和安全。首先,应对存储在数据仓库中的敏感数据进行加密,防止数据泄露。其次,应建立严格的访问控制机制,确保只有授权用户才能访问特定的数据。同时,企业还需定期进行安全审计,及时发现和修复潜在的安全漏洞。此外,建立数据备份和恢复机制,确保在发生意外情况下能够快速恢复数据。通过综合措施,企业能够确保数据仓库的安全性和合规性,保护客户的信任。

    八、优化性能和查询速度

    数据仓库的性能和查询速度直接影响到数据分析的效率。为了优化性能,企业可以采取多种措施。首先,合理设计数据模型,减少数据冗余,提高查询效率。其次,使用索引和分区等技术,提升数据检索的速度。此外,定期进行数据归档,将历史数据移至低成本存储中,减轻主数据仓库的负担。对于复杂的查询,企业还可以考虑使用数据预处理和缓存技术,加速查询响应时间。通过持续的性能优化,企业能够确保数据仓库在高负载情况下依然能够快速响应用户的查询需求,从而提升整体的工作效率。

    九、实施数据治理

    数据治理是确保数据质量、合规性和安全性的管理框架。企业在构建数据仓库时,应建立一套完善的数据治理机制。这包括制定数据管理政策、建立数据标准和规范、设立数据责任人等。通过明确数据的所有权和责任,企业能够有效管理数据生命周期,确保数据的准确性和一致性。此外,数据治理还应包括数据使用的监控和审计,及时发现和处理数据使用中的问题。通过实施数据治理,企业能够增强数据的可控性,提高数据的利用效率,推动业务决策的科学化和数据化。

    十、进行培训和文化建设

    在数据仓库的建设过程中,人员培训和文化建设是不可忽视的环节。企业需要对员工进行数据分析技能的培训,使他们能够充分利用数据仓库中的信息进行决策。此外,应积极推动数据驱动文化的建设,让员工意识到数据分析的重要性,并鼓励他们在日常工作中使用数据。通过定期举办培训课程、研讨会和分享会,企业能够提升员工的数据素养,促进数据的广泛应用。文化建设还包括建立数据共享机制,鼓励不同部门之间的信息交流,提高整体的数据利用效率。通过培训和文化建设,企业能够实现数据仓库的最大价值,为业务发展提供强有力的支持。

    1年前 0条评论
  • Larissa
    这个人很懒,什么都没有留下~
    评论

    和系统优化。主要步骤包括:性能监控、数据质量管理、系统优化和维护计划。

    1. 性能监控:监控数据仓库的性能,包括数据查询响应时间、数据加载速度等,及时发现和解决性能问题。

    2. 数据质量管理:定期进行数据质量检查,确保数据的准确性和一致性,处理数据质量问题。

    3. 系统优化:根据业务需求和数据增长情况,对数据仓库进行优化,包括调整数据模型、优化查询性能等。

    4. 维护计划:制定数据仓库的维护计划,包括定期的系统检查、更新和备份,确保数据仓库的稳定性和可靠性。

    1年前 0条评论

传统式报表开发 VS 自助式数据分析

一站式数据分析平台,大大提升分析效率

数据准备
数据编辑
数据可视化
分享协作
可连接多种数据源,一键接入数据库表或导入Excel
可视化编辑数据,过滤合并计算,完全不需要SQL
内置50+图表和联动钻取特效,可视化呈现数据故事
可多人协同编辑仪表板,复用他人报表,一键分享发布
BI分析看板Demo>

每个人都能上手数据分析,提升业务

通过大数据分析工具FineBI,每个人都能充分了解并利用他们的数据,辅助决策、提升业务。

销售人员
财务人员
人事专员
运营人员
库存管理人员
经营管理人员

销售人员

销售部门人员可通过IT人员制作的业务包轻松完成销售主题的探索分析,轻松掌握企业销售目标、销售活动等数据。在管理和实现企业销售目标的过程中做到数据在手,心中不慌。

FineBI助力高效分析
易用的自助式BI轻松实现业务分析
随时根据异常情况进行战略调整
免费试用FineBI

财务人员

财务分析往往是企业运营中重要的一环,当财务人员通过固定报表发现净利润下降,可立刻拉出各个业务、机构、产品等结构进行分析。实现智能化的财务运营。

FineBI助力高效分析
丰富的函数应用,支撑各类财务数据分析场景
打通不同条线数据源,实现数据共享
免费试用FineBI

人事专员

人事专员通过对人力资源数据进行分析,有助于企业定时开展人才盘点,系统化对组织结构和人才管理进行建设,为人员的选、聘、育、留提供充足的决策依据。

FineBI助力高效分析
告别重复的人事数据分析过程,提高效率
数据权限的灵活分配确保了人事数据隐私
免费试用FineBI

运营人员

运营人员可以通过可视化化大屏的形式直观展示公司业务的关键指标,有助于从全局层面加深对业务的理解与思考,做到让数据驱动运营。

FineBI助力高效分析
高效灵活的分析路径减轻了业务人员的负担
协作共享功能避免了内部业务信息不对称
免费试用FineBI

库存管理人员

库存管理是影响企业盈利能力的重要因素之一,管理不当可能导致大量的库存积压。因此,库存管理人员需要对库存体系做到全盘熟稔于心。

FineBI助力高效分析
为决策提供数据支持,还原库存体系原貌
对重点指标设置预警,及时发现并解决问题
免费试用FineBI

经营管理人员

经营管理人员通过搭建数据分析驾驶舱,打通生产、销售、售后等业务域之间数据壁垒,有利于实现对企业的整体把控与决策分析,以及有助于制定企业后续的战略规划。

FineBI助力高效分析
融合多种数据源,快速构建数据中心
高级计算能力让经营者也能轻松驾驭BI
免费试用FineBI

帆软大数据分析平台的优势

01

一站式大数据平台

从源头打通和整合各种数据资源,实现从数据提取、集成到数据清洗、加工、前端可视化分析与展现。所有操作都可在一个平台完成,每个企业都可拥有自己的数据分析平台。

02

高性能数据引擎

90%的千万级数据量内多表合并秒级响应,可支持10000+用户在线查看,低于1%的更新阻塞率,多节点智能调度,全力支持企业级数据分析。

03

全方位数据安全保护

编辑查看导出敏感数据可根据数据权限设置脱敏,支持cookie增强、文件上传校验等安全防护,以及平台内可配置全局水印、SQL防注防止恶意参数输入。

04

IT与业务的最佳配合

FineBI能让业务不同程度上掌握分析能力,入门级可快速获取数据和完成图表可视化;中级可完成数据处理与多维分析;高级可完成高阶计算与复杂分析,IT大大降低工作量。

使用自助式BI工具,解决企业应用数据难题

数据分析平台,bi数据可视化工具

数据分析,一站解决

数据准备
数据编辑
数据可视化
分享协作

可连接多种数据源,一键接入数据库表或导入Excel

数据分析平台,bi数据可视化工具

可视化编辑数据,过滤合并计算,完全不需要SQL

数据分析平台,bi数据可视化工具

图表和联动钻取特效,可视化呈现数据故事

数据分析平台,bi数据可视化工具

可多人协同编辑仪表板,复用他人报表,一键分享发布

数据分析平台,bi数据可视化工具

每个人都能使用FineBI分析数据,提升业务

销售人员
财务人员
人事专员
运营人员
库存管理人员
经营管理人员

销售人员

销售部门人员可通过IT人员制作的业务包轻松完成销售主题的探索分析,轻松掌握企业销售目标、销售活动等数据。在管理和实现企业销售目标的过程中做到数据在手,心中不慌。

易用的自助式BI轻松实现业务分析

随时根据异常情况进行战略调整

数据分析平台,bi数据可视化工具

财务人员

财务分析往往是企业运营中重要的一环,当财务人员通过固定报表发现净利润下降,可立刻拉出各个业务、机构、产品等结构进行分析。实现智能化的财务运营。

丰富的函数应用,支撑各类财务数据分析场景

打通不同条线数据源,实现数据共享

数据分析平台,bi数据可视化工具

人事专员

人事专员通过对人力资源数据进行分析,有助于企业定时开展人才盘点,系统化对组织结构和人才管理进行建设,为人员的选、聘、育、留提供充足的决策依据。

告别重复的人事数据分析过程,提高效率

数据权限的灵活分配确保了人事数据隐私

数据分析平台,bi数据可视化工具

运营人员

运营人员可以通过可视化化大屏的形式直观展示公司业务的关键指标,有助于从全局层面加深对业务的理解与思考,做到让数据驱动运营。

高效灵活的分析路径减轻了业务人员的负担

协作共享功能避免了内部业务信息不对称

数据分析平台,bi数据可视化工具

库存管理人员

库存管理是影响企业盈利能力的重要因素之一,管理不当可能导致大量的库存积压。因此,库存管理人员需要对库存体系做到全盘熟稔于心。

为决策提供数据支持,还原库存体系原貌

对重点指标设置预警,及时发现并解决问题

数据分析平台,bi数据可视化工具

经营管理人员

经营管理人员通过搭建数据分析驾驶舱,打通生产、销售、售后等业务域之间数据壁垒,有利于实现对企业的整体把控与决策分析,以及有助于制定企业后续的战略规划。

融合多种数据源,快速构建数据中心

高级计算能力让经营者也能轻松驾驭BI

数据分析平台,bi数据可视化工具

商品分析痛点剖析

01

打造一站式数据分析平台

一站式数据处理与分析平台帮助企业汇通各个业务系统,从源头打通和整合各种数据资源,实现从数据提取、集成到数据清洗、加工、前端可视化分析与展现,帮助企业真正从数据中提取价值,提高企业的经营能力。

02

定义IT与业务最佳配合模式

FineBI以其低门槛的特性,赋予业务部门不同级别的能力:入门级,帮助用户快速获取数据和完成图表可视化;中级,帮助用户完成数据处理与多维分析;高级,帮助用户完成高阶计算与复杂分析。

03

深入洞察业务,快速解决

依托BI分析平台,开展基于业务问题的探索式分析,锁定关键影响因素,快速响应,解决业务危机或抓住市场机遇,从而促进业务目标高效率达成。

04

打造一站式数据分析平台

一站式数据处理与分析平台帮助企业汇通各个业务系统,从源头打通和整合各种数据资源,实现从数据提取、集成到数据清洗、加工、前端可视化分析与展现,帮助企业真正从数据中提取价值,提高企业的经营能力。

电话咨询
电话咨询
电话热线: 400-811-8890转1
商务咨询: 点击申请专人服务
技术咨询
技术咨询
在线技术咨询: 立即沟通
紧急服务热线: 400-811-8890转2
微信咨询
微信咨询
扫码添加专属售前顾问免费获取更多行业资料
投诉入口
投诉入口
总裁办24H投诉: 173-127-81526
商务咨询